Chapter 333



Linghu Sheng floated in the air, his eyes were bloodshot, his long robe fluttered without wind, and he was surrounded by ominous black mist.

Huo Shaoying's expression changed drastically when she saw the mist: "Demonic energy—Linghu Sheng, how dare you secretly learn demonic arts!"

Linghu Sheng laughed maniacally, his lips splayed out in an exaggerated grin, and said, "Orthodox and evil arts, aren't they all judged by you hypocrites! Today I've killed you, killed your bastard master, and from now on, what is righteous and what is evil will be decided by me!"

Without waiting for Huo Shaoying's reaction, he raised his hand and slashed at the window of the private room with his knife.

The walls collapsed with a crash, and a fierce gust of wind rushed into the room, instantly leaving the floor in a mess. The guards, who had just managed to stand up, were blown down again.

Despite being protected by magical artifacts, Huo Shaoying was still blown backward repeatedly. She barely managed to steady herself and was about to retaliate when she suddenly caught a glimpse of Nan Xian lying motionless on the floor not far away, while the wardrobe above her head was swaying precariously.

Her expression changed, and without thinking, she instinctively took out her protective magic artifact and threw it over.

The magical artifact landed beside Nan Xian and activated automatically, raising a pale golden dome that enveloped her entirely.

The next second, the wardrobe fell over and landed squarely on the protective shield.

However, in that moment of distraction, Huo Shaoying lost her best chance to retaliate. Linghu Sheng appeared in front of her in an instant, turning his blade into a knife and stabbing it towards her chest.

In a flash, Huo Shaoying raised her arm to block the fatal blow. She gritted her teeth and endured the excruciating pain. With her other intact hand, she grabbed in the air and immediately produced a packet of powder, which she then threw at Linghu Sheng's face.

Linghu Sheng was caught off guard and hit squarely by the powder, his vision immediately blurring. He cursed "despicable scoundrel" and retreated while trying to use a cleansing spell to remove the powder.

Seeing this, several guards took the opportunity to attack from behind. However, Linghu Sheng was protected by demonic energy, and even with their combined efforts, they could only cut his long robe a few times without harming him in the slightest.

Everyone was shocked—what kind of evil magic was it that was as powerful as an invincible shield or iron shirt?

Linghu Sheng had regained his sight by then. He saw the guards surrounding him warily, glanced down at his torn clothes, and sneered.

"Truly—ignorant of one's own limitations!"

He let out a low roar, and his demonic energy surged, the mist transforming into long black spikes that shot out in all directions.

The guards were no match for him. The unlucky ones were pierced through the chest by the long spikes and died on the spot. Those who were lucky enough to avoid being hit in a vital spot suffered even more. The demonic energy in the long spikes entered their bodies through the wounds and immediately tried to take over their bodies. The "native" spiritual energy in their bodies was naturally unwilling to accept this. The two completely opposite energies fought and struggled in their bodies. The guards rolled on the ground in pain and howled in agony.

“A bunch of ants…” Linghu Sheng chuckled as he approached Huo Shaoying step by step.

Huo Shaoying looked at the guards who had lost their fighting ability, and her heart sank. She knew that if she were to face Linghu Sheng, who was protected by demonic energy, with her own strength, it would be like an egg hitting a rock.

The array in this private room was extremely tricky, unlike anything she had ever seen before, and she certainly couldn't unravel it in a short time...

She closed her eyes, clutching her injured and bleeding arm as she stepped forward.

“Linghu Sheng, let’s make a deal. You want to win, right? I’ll help you take the leader’s position, and you—”

Before she could finish speaking, Linghu Sheng grabbed her by the neck.

He used all his strength, grabbing her and lifting her up. Huo Shaoying's face turned red. She tried to stand on tiptoe and pry his hands off with her hands, her fingernails scratching bloody marks on the back of his hands.

"A deal? What right do you have to talk to me about a deal? Heh, go talk to the King of Hell—" Linghu Sheng remained motionless as if he felt no pain. He grinned as he looked her over, watching her struggle to open her mouth wide to breathe. Her face turned from red to bluish-purple, and veins bulged on her forehead. Her struggles grew weaker and weaker.

Just then—

"Um?"

A drowsy female voice came from the side.

Then came a gasp:

"Holy crap! Where's my hair?!"
